Creating a Profile
Before you can use the Profile Manager, you need to create a profile.
Follow
these steps to create a profile.
1. If not already, turn ON the Profile Manager mode by pressing the
"Activate
Profile Manager Mode" button (c).
2. The "Profile Name" field (a) will become active. Click inside of the
Profile Name field and type in the name you want to call the profile,
such as "Home" (e).
3. At this point, you now need to set the rest of the parameters for the
network that you will be connecting to. Set the Operating Mode,
Encryption settings, Network Type, SSID, etc. When you have finished
making these settings, click "Apply" (b).
A profile with the name you chose now exists in the Profile Manager.
You can
select this profile quickly and easily any time you need to use it
Choosing a Profile
You can quickly and easily choose a profile any time you need it. There
are two
methods to do so.
Quick Pick
1. Right-click the Utility icon in the task bar.
2. Place your cursor over "Profile". A list of the
profiles you have created will appear. Move the
cursor over the profile that you want to use and
left-click on the name. The profile you just
selected will become active.
Choosing from the Utility
1. Make sure Profile Manager mode is on.
2. Click the down-facing arrow next to "Profile Name". A list of all of the
profiles you have created will appear. Click on the name of the profile
you
want to use.
